BIOGRAPHY
Quartertime Witch is a four-piece student band from Nottingham, England. They met within the first week of university and have been in a band ever since. The first band formed in 2003 called the Copouts (consisting of the current band members as well as a rapper Omar who sadly left before their first gig) disbanded in 2004 after a poor crowd performance at ISIS. Upon the break up of the pangea, the band reformed in 2005 and are now permanently known as Quartertime Witch. Practising songs in a student box house they have learnt how to effectively create a B grade song without the need of fancy recording equipment. Realising the need to get out of the house and see daylight, the band members emerged from the dark in 2006 recorded a few songs in a studio and within a few weeks, they were booked with 2 gigs, was featured on TPN rock radio, got interviewed and entered a Battle of the Bands competition.
